2025 Honda CR-V Sport Hybrid: A Blend of Efficiency and Sportiness?

The Honda CR-V has long been a staple in the compact SUV segment, known for its reliability and practicality. With the 2025 model year, Honda is aiming to elevate the CR-V further by introducing a Sport Hybrid variant. But does this new addition truly deliver on its promise of blending sporty performance with hybrid efficiency? Let's delve into the details.

What's New for the 2025 Honda CR-V Sport Hybrid?

The 2025 Honda CR-V Sport Hybrid distinguishes itself primarily through its powertrain. While exact specifications are still emerging, we anticipate a significant improvement over previous hybrid systems. This likely involves a more powerful electric motor working in tandem with a refined gasoline engine, resulting in:

  • Increased Horsepower and Torque: Expect a noticeable boost in both horsepower and torque compared to previous CR-V hybrid models, leading to quicker acceleration and improved responsiveness.
  • Enhanced Fuel Efficiency: The hybrid system should provide excellent fuel economy, making it a cost-effective choice for daily commuting and longer trips. Specific MPG figures will be crucial once released by Honda.
  • Sharper Handling: While not a full-fledged sports SUV, the Sport Hybrid trim might incorporate suspension and steering tweaks for a more engaging driving experience, offering better handling and responsiveness than standard CR-V models.

Competition:

The 2025 Honda CR-V Sport Hybrid will face stiff competition from other hybrid and plug-in hybrid SUVs in the market, including:

  • Toyota RAV4 Hybrid: A long-standing competitor known for its reliability and fuel efficiency.
  • Ford Escape Hybrid: Offers a blend of practicality and hybrid technology.
  • Kia Sportage Hybrid: Known for its stylish design and features.
